Ilocos mayor-elect survives ambush; aides killed

CAMP FLORENDO, La Union , Philippines  – The elected mayor of Pagudpud, Ilocos Norte has survived an ambush on Monday afternoon but her two escorts were killed and one was injured in the attack staged by unidentified suspects along the boundary of Burgos and Bangui towns.  

Superintendent Raul Romero, chief of the publication information office here, identified the fatalities as Mario Monje and Fertopel Caletena, both aides of Mayor-elect Matilde Sales.

Sales was unhurt in the attack along with two other companions while the driver of the van, a certain Manolito Rangasan, was wounded and was brought for treatment at the Gov. Roque Ablan Sr. Memorial Hospital. 

Romero, quoting reports from authorities in Ilocos Norte, said the incident happened at around 5 p.m. while Sales’ group, on board a van, was traveling the highway at a mountainous area between the boundary of Bangui and Burgos when the assailants fired at them with M16 Armalite rifle.  

Police said the suspects fled immediately while investigators recovered seven empty shells of M16 at the crime scene. 

Romero said motive of the incident is still unknown and police have launched intensified checkpoints in the area.   – With Teddy Molina
